About The Company
Oro Loma Sanitary District provides wastewater collection and treatment services, and residential and commercial solid waste and recycling services to its customers. The District strives to "Provide the best possible service at the lowest possible cost."
About the Role

THE POSITION:

This is a working manager position responsible for performing professional financial and accounting duties for the District’s sewage collection and treatment and solid waste programs. A key focus is to manage the broad arena of finance while also ensuring the basics are completed. 

EXAMPLES OF JOB DUTIES:

Preparing and managing operating and capital budgets, performing cash flow projections, generating Annual Comprehensive Financial Reports, and managing District loans. Additionally, the position is responsible for monthly financial reports, annual independent audit, cash and investment management, accounts payable, payroll, and other duties as assigned. THE IDEAL CANDIDATE:

  • Is able to function in a culture of doing more with less and wearing many hats;
  • Has a strong customer service focus and desire to make government work;
  • Has a keen eye for detail;
  • Possesses the highest degree of ethics; 
  • Must embrace the day-to-day operations of finance; and,
  • Has demonstrated excellent working relationships within all levels in the organization.

EXPERIENCE AND EDUCATION: Any combination of education and experience, which would provide the required knowledge and abilities, is qualifying.

Five years of increasingly responsible accounting, budgeting, or finance experience preferably within a municipal or utility enterprise agency; and equivalent to a Bachelor’s degree from an accredited college or university with major emphasis in finance, accounting, or business administration.
